    Exclamation I need more advice. Pentium 4N 2ghz

    Anybody know what temperature is considered unhealthy when overclocking a pentium 4n 2ghz.

    I have a gigabyte Rocket cpu cooler strapped too it. =)

    Slightly overclocked it too 2.2ghz and ran sp2004 for around 5-10 minutes, the average temp was 40, with a 44 peak.

    Whats the temp where i should scream and panic like a girl?
